I'm experiencing some problems with Channel 9's HD recordings on my HTPC (AMD 3200+, 1GB Ram).

When I use VLC - it crashes within the first couple of seconds. DivX player plays appx halfway through the file and then crashes the playback. PC recovers normally, but the CPU is running at 100% and then the playback just halts. It seems to attempt a recovery, but fails to do so and closes the app.

These files normally runs fine on my laptop.

SD recordings are fine. Channel 10 and Channel 7 plays ok, but through VLC occationally stutters.

Any advise on which direction to go - new graphics card, more memory, ????

probably need to clean up the errors in the files.

Run through Project X or Video ReDo Quick Stream Fix.

Use Media Player Classic with ffdshow for best PQ.
